Fiber (dietary fiber) is one of the most important elements of human nutrition. Dietary fibers help to resist harmful environmental factors, reduce the toxic load on the body and have a whole range of useful properties:
– helps to control weight, due to its ability to absorb water and increase in volume, filling the space of the stomach, thereby reducing appetite and the number of calories absorbed. They slow down the absorption of carbohydrates into the blood, reducing the insulin demand and sweet cravings;
— they are a nutrient medium for normal intestinal microflora, so they are used to prevent and correct intestinal dysbacteriosis;
— they are a universal biological absorbent-bind and remove toxins and heavy metals from the body;
— swell in the intestines, softening its contents;
– have a mild choleretic effect;
– slow down the amylolysis and prevent a rapid glucose escape;
– bind cholesterol, reducing its level.
